Lactobacillus jensenii is a normal inhabitant of the lower reproductive tract in healthy women. L. jensenii makes up 23% of vaginal microflora that is naturally occurring. It is also found on the skins of grapes at the time of their harvest. L. jensenii is sometimes used in producing fermented foods.

Novel lactobacillus strains, and composition and application thereof

PCT designated stageWO2025261345A1Antibacterial agentsBacteriaGardnerellaMicrobiology
Disclosed are novel Lactobacillus strains, relating to a new Lactobacillus crispatus V435 strain and a new Lactobacillus jensenii V216 strain, and a composition comprising the strains used in the prevention or treatment of vaginitis. The Lactobacillus crispatus V435 strain is capable of producing lactic acid at a high yield, and the Lactobacillus jensenii V216 strain is capable of producing lactic acid and hydrogen peroxide at a high yield. Both strains have an excellent ability to inhibit clinically isolated Gardnerella, clinically isolated Atopobium, and fungi, a good ability to inhibit mixed vaginal pathogenic flora, and can be stably colonized in vaginal environments to become a dominant flora therein. The two strains exhibit a mutually beneficial symbiotic relationship without generating an antagonistic effect, and also exhibit a synergistic effect, resulting in stronger probiotic capabilities than a single dominant strain.

A probiotic beadlet comprising lactobacillus salivarius and bifidobacterium longum and a method of making the same

The application provides a probiotic crystal ball preparation containing lactobacillus jensenii and bifidobacterium longum, which comprises a shell structure and a core structure, wherein the shell structure comprises gelatin, glycerol and water; and the core structure comprises lactobacillus jensenii, bifidobacterium longum and hydrogenated oil. The lactobacillus jensenii has a preservation number of CCTCC NO: M2022172; and the bifidobacterium longum has a preservation number of CCTCC NO: M2019780. The application adopts a double-layer seamless capsule technology with gelatin as the shell material, hydrogenated oil and bacterial powder as the core, so that the probiotics can not be digested by gastric juice and have a high survival rate in the intestinal tract. Moreover, the core of the application uses the screened lactobacillus jensenii VHProbi A17 strain which does not produce hemolysin and cannot dissolve blood cells, and has safety. The lactobacillus jensenii has scavenging effects on DPPH free radicals and hydroxyl radicals, and has a wide antibacterial spectrum.
